The Best Tips for Cleaning Up After A Washing Machine
Exactly how you hand those valuable mins after your washing equipment leaks and also floodings can influence exactly how fast your home obtains recovered. Knowing what you should do as well as that to call can save you from significant damages. It will likewise help aid you in filing for house owners insurance policy protection. Shut off the Power.


Turn of the circuit breaker where the washing device is. It is important to ensure the washing machine is off. Water is a conductor, and also doing this action ensures no person experiences electrocution. Besides, you need to not use your washer till an expert technician has evaluated it.

Secure the Standing Water.


As you wait on the plumber or repair work service technician ahead, you have to handle the flood. If your washer remains in the cellar with considerable flooding, you need a submersible pump to secure the water. You can rent out or obtain this. However, if it occurs in the middle of the evening, the old bucket method will certainly likewise work. Use numerous containers to by hand dispose out the water. It would certainly be best if you did this right away, as the longer the water stays, the extra considerable the damage.

Call the Pros.


If you suspect the problem is with your water line, you require to call a qualified plumber. Nonetheless, if you are not sure, call a washing machine repairman for a fast analysis. He or she can inform you finest what the issue is. Maybe an issue with the device itself or the pipes connecting to the device.

Document the Damages.


Before tidying up this emergency flooding scenario, you should document whatever. Keep in mind, images, as well as video clips. It would be best if you had all of this as proof to sustain your insurance policy claims. After that you can call your homeowner's insurance policy provider to inspect what other demands they need to process your demand.

Vacuum Cleaner Any Remaining Water.


Making use of a wet/dry vacuum cleaner, eliminate the remainder of the water, and draw it from porous products like walls, drywall, floor covering, as well as carpeting.

Shut Off Supply Of Water.


You need to turn off the water of the equipment. Whether it overruns for unknown reasons, breaks down in the reduced pipelines, or ruptures the primary hose pipe, you will certainly be taking care of remarkable amounts of water. If the regional supply line to the washer doesn't close it off, you must shut off the main water valve outside your residence.

Dry the Location as Much as Feasible.


After taking out the standing water, get sponges or old towels to draw out as much water from the floor or carpet. Keep the home windows available to distribute the air. You might likewise utilize electric followers to quicken the drying procedure. Keep in mind, water will certainly trigger mold as well as mold and mildew development which is harmful to your wellness. If you feel that the situation is excessive to take care of, you can likewise seek water elimination solutions from a remediation firm. Your insurance coverage claim might additionally aid spend for this solution, so simply ask.
Keep in mind, a damaged washing machine with leaking pipelines will certainly cause disastrous damages due to the massive quantities of water it can offload. Therefore, it would certainly assist to have your equipment and also water lines examined each year. You can seek help from a reputable plumber to change your supply line tubes. Doing assessments prevents difficult malfunctions and pricey breakdowns.

Washing Machine Flood Inspection Help & Tips


The source of the water from a washing machine loss could be from a water supply line, a waste water line, or a faulty part inside the unit itself such as the pump. Safety should always be the first concern. When water is present there is always the potential for an electrical hazard. If you are unsure, it s best not to enter the area.



If you can safely enter the area, the hot and cold water supply valves should be turned off behind the unit. If you cannot safely reach the valves or if a valve has failed, shut off the main water valve to the property. Once the water supply has been shut off the water supply lines will need to be detached and drained into a container. If the washing machine has water in the drum and it is/was not possible to run the spin or drain cycle, the drum will need to be drained manually with a cup or small bucket.



The waste water drain line will need to be removed from the drain inlet, and the dryer vent ducting will need to be detached. The washing machine and dryer will need to be moved in order to allow inspection of the walls and floor around the unit. Without a using a Dolly this can be difficult.



Once the units have been uninstalled, the walls, baseboard, and flooring materials can be tested for abnormal or high moisture content.
